## COPD Care in the Mountain State: A Look at Hospitals Near ZIP Code 26833

Navigating the healthcare landscape, especially for chronic conditions like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D), requires informed decisions. For residents near ZIP code 26833, which encompasses the rural area around Petersburg, West Virginia, access to quality pulmonary care is paramount. This review examines the available hospital options, focusing on factors crucial for COPD patients: overall hospital quality, specialized pulmonary services, emergency room efficiency, and telehealth capabilities.

**Proximity and Primary Options**

The immediate vicinity of Petersburg (26833) presents limited direct hospital options. Residents typically look to larger regional centers for specialized care. The closest significant hospitals are in Morgantown, approximately a two-hour drive, and Cumberland, Maryland, roughly an hour and a half away. Both offer a wider array of services and are critical considerations for COPD patients.

**West Virginia University Medicine (WVU Medicine) – Morgantown**

WVU Medicine, anchored by the West Virginia University (WVU) Hospitals in Morgantown, is a major healthcare provider in the state. WVU Hospitals is a large, tertiary care center and a teaching hospital. While specific COPD-focused centers may not be explicitly named, the hospital's pulmonology department is robust, with a team of board-certified pulmonologists, respiratory therapists, and support staff.

WVU Hospitals holds a 3-star rating from the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S). This rating reflects overall hospital quality based on factors like patient outcomes, safety, and patient experience. While not the highest possible rating, it provides a benchmark for comparison.

Emergency room wait times at WVU Hospitals can fluctuate. According to recent data, the average wait time to see a provider is around 45-60 minutes. However, this can vary significantly depending on the time of day and the volume of patients. For COPD patients experiencing acute exacerbations, minimizing wait times is crucial.

WVU Medicine has invested in telehealth initiatives. They offer virtual consultations and remote monitoring programs, which can be particularly beneficial for COPD patients managing their condition from home. These telehealth options can facilitate regular check-ins, medication adjustments, and early intervention to prevent hospitalizations. The availability of these services is a significant advantage for patients in rural areas.

**UPMC Western Maryland – Cumberland, Maryland**

UPMC Western Maryland, located in Cumberland, Maryland, offers another critical option for residents near 26833. This hospital is a regional medical center with a comprehensive pulmonary department. They offer a full range of services, including pulmonary function testing, bronchoscopy, and respiratory therapy.

UPMC Western Maryland currently holds a 3-star rating from CMS. This rating, similar to WVU Hospitals, indicates a solid level of quality, though it is not at the highest tier.

Emergency room wait times at UPMC Western Maryland are generally comparable to WVU Hospitals, averaging around 45-60 minutes. However, as with any ER, wait times can be unpredictable.

UPMC Western Maryland has expanded its telehealth offerings in recent years. Telehealth services can provide COPD patients with easier access to specialists, medication management, and education. The hospital’s telehealth programs can be invaluable for patients in rural areas, reducing the need for frequent travel.

**Access to Pulmonary Rehabilitation**

Pulmonary rehabilitation is a crucial component of COPD management. Both WVU Medicine and UPMC Western Maryland offer pulmonary rehabilitation programs. These programs provide exercise training, education, and support to improve lung function, reduce symptoms, and enhance quality of life.

**Research and Clinical Trials**

WVU Medicine, as a teaching hospital, is involved in medical research and clinical trials. Patients may have the opportunity to participate in research studies that explore new treatments for COPD.
